Buying a Used Vehicle? Don't Skip the VIN Check!

Purchasing a pre-owned car can be a fantastic way to save money. However, it's crucial to take precautions to ensure you're getting a genuine vehicle with no hidden issues. That's where a VIN check comes in! The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) is like a car's fingerprint, providing a wealth of information about its past. A thorough VIN check can reveal essential details such as accidents, repairs, mileage accuracy, and even if the vehicle was ever repossessed. By uncovering this helpful information, you can make a educated decision about your used car purchase and protect yourself from potential headaches down the road.
